What Makes Direct-to-Metal Paint Different?
Unlike traditional paints that require a primer to bond to surfaces, direct-to-metal paint contains built-in adhesion and rust-inhibiting properties. This makes it both time-saving and cost-efficient for projects that demand speed and simplicity without compromising quality.
DTM paint formulations typically include high-solids content and specialty resins that promote excellent bonding to ferrous and non-ferrous metals. These coatings are designed to withstand harsh conditions, making them suitable for industrial, commercial, and outdoor applications where environmental exposure is a concern.

Surface Preparation Still Matters
Although DTM paints reduce the need for a separate primer, surface prep is still critical. Dirt, rust, oil, or old coatings can interfere with adhesion, so it’s essential to clean the metal thoroughly using sandblasting, wire brushing, or solvent cleaning methods.
For best results, professionals assess the type of metal, environmental conditions, and exposure risks before choosing the specific DTM formulation. Proper application using airless sprayers or rollers ensures an even finish and consistent protection.
Outdoor Metal Surfaces and Weather Resistance
For exterior applications, the ability of DTM paint to withstand weather extremes is particularly valuable. It’s built-in rust inhibitors protect the metal from oxidation and corrosion caused by rain, humidity, and UV exposure. This makes DTM paint essential for maintaining outdoor metal surfaces, such as gates, staircases, and rooftops, in both residential and commercial environments.
